Strong's #3659 - כָּנְיָהוּ
Transliteration
Konyâhûw
Phonetics
kon-yaw'-hoo
Root Word (Etymology)
for (H3204)
Parts of Speech
proper masculine noun
TWOT
None
Definition
- Brown-Driver-Briggs
- Strong
Brown-Driver-Briggs'
Coniah = “Jehovah will establish”
1) another name for king Jehoiachin of Judah, the next to last king on the throne before the captivity
